The Collemataceae are a family of mostly lichen-forming fungi in the order Peltigerales. The family contains twelve genera and about 325 species. The family has a widespread distribution.

==Taxonomy== The family was circumscribed by Jonathan Carl Zenker in 1827; Collema is the type genus.
